
Software Engineer (Java Cloud DevOps)
Salary undisclosed
Checking job availability...
Original
Simplified
Required Skills:
- Java
- Python
- NoSQL
- DevOps
- Cloud Services
- AWS
- JavaScript
Software Application Developer
Responsibilities:
Design, develop, test, and maintain software applications.
Write clean, scalable, and efficient code following best practices.
Troubleshoot and resolve application bugs and issues.
Implement backend services, APIs, and database logic.
Collaborate with cross-functional teams including UI/UX designers and business analysts.
Follow Agile methodologies and participate in sprint planning meetings.
Develop responsive web applications using front-end frameworks.
Ensure data consistency and integrity through proper database management.
Conduct performance testing and optimizations for application speed and security.
Maintain system documentation and update technical manuals.
Develop and maintain RESTful APIs for integration with third-party systems.
Implement authentication and authorization mechanisms.
Support application deployments and resolve post-deployment issues.
Monitor system performance and implement improvements.
Assist in migrating legacy applications to modern technology stacks.
Implement secure coding practices to prevent vulnerabilities.
Work with DevOps to streamline deployment pipelines.
Optimize front-end performance and implement caching strategies.
Integrate with cloud-based services and APIs.
Participate in software design discussions and suggest improvements.
Develop reusable components for efficient development cycles.
Implement error handling and logging mechanisms.
Write SQL queries and optimize database interactions.
Debug cross-browser compatibility issues.
Automate repetitive development tasks using scripts.
Create scalable and maintainable applications to meet the WDA's long-term needs.
Integrate and maintain business-driven workflows into the application platform.
Implement data entry forms and reporting tools in alignment with business requirements.
Use agile principles to prioritize development tasks and meet business deadlines.
Create and optimize SQL queries for reporting tools and financial data processing.
Develop and integrate automated notifications and reminders related to project timelines and submissions.
Implement real-time data updates and ensure they are visible on the executive dashboards.
Work with project teams to refine product features based on user feedback and testing results.
Ensure all code is optimized for both performance and scalability.
Work with the team to transition legacy systems to modern frameworks.
Ensure secure coding practices for web and mobile applications.
Troubleshoot front-end and back-end application issues and bugs.
Responsibilities:
Design, develop, test, and maintain software applications.
Write clean, scalable, and efficient code following best practices.
Troubleshoot and resolve application bugs and issues.
Implement backend services, APIs, and database logic.
Collaborate with cross-functional teams including UI/UX designers and business analysts.
Follow Agile methodologies and participate in sprint planning meetings.
Develop responsive web applications using front-end frameworks.
Ensure data consistency and integrity through proper database management.
Conduct performance testing and optimizations for application speed and security.
Maintain system documentation and update technical manuals.
Develop and maintain RESTful APIs for integration with third-party systems.
Implement authentication and authorization mechanisms.
Support application deployments and resolve post-deployment issues.
Monitor system performance and implement improvements.
Assist in migrating legacy applications to modern technology stacks.
Implement secure coding practices to prevent vulnerabilities.
Work with DevOps to streamline deployment pipelines.
Optimize front-end performance and implement caching strategies.
Integrate with cloud-based services and APIs.
Participate in software design discussions and suggest improvements.
Develop reusable components for efficient development cycles.
Implement error handling and logging mechanisms.
Write SQL queries and optimize database interactions.
Debug cross-browser compatibility issues.
Automate repetitive development tasks using scripts.
Create scalable and maintainable applications to meet the WDA's long-term needs.
Integrate and maintain business-driven workflows into the application platform.
Implement data entry forms and reporting tools in alignment with business requirements.
Use agile principles to prioritize development tasks and meet business deadlines.
Create and optimize SQL queries for reporting tools and financial data processing.
Develop and integrate automated notifications and reminders related to project timelines and submissions.
Implement real-time data updates and ensure they are visible on the executive dashboards.
Work with project teams to refine product features based on user feedback and testing results.
Ensure all code is optimized for both performance and scalability.
Work with the team to transition legacy systems to modern frameworks.
Ensure secure coding practices for web and mobile applications.
Troubleshoot front-end and back-end application issues and bugs.
Qualifications:
Bachelor's degree in Computer Science or related field.
2+ years of experience in software development.
Knowledge of front-end and back-end technologies.
Ability to work collaboratively with other team members.
Experience with APIs and cloud-based technologies.
Bachelor's degree in Computer Science or related field.
2+ years of experience in software development.
Knowledge of front-end and back-end technologies.
Ability to work collaboratively with other team members.
Experience with APIs and cloud-based technologies.
Technology Stacks:
Languages: Java, C#, JavaScript, Python
Frameworks: React, Angular, Vue.js, Node.js
Databases: MongoDB, MySQL, PostgreSQL
Tools: Git, Jenkins, Jira, Docker
Cloud: AWS, Azure, Google Cloud
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
Report this job Required Skills:
- Java
- Python
- NoSQL
- DevOps
- Cloud Services
- AWS
- JavaScript
Software Application Developer
Responsibilities:
Design, develop, test, and maintain software applications.
Write clean, scalable, and efficient code following best practices.
Troubleshoot and resolve application bugs and issues.
Implement backend services, APIs, and database logic.
Collaborate with cross-functional teams including UI/UX designers and business analysts.
Follow Agile methodologies and participate in sprint planning meetings.
Develop responsive web applications using front-end frameworks.
Ensure data consistency and integrity through proper database management.
Conduct performance testing and optimizations for application speed and security.
Maintain system documentation and update technical manuals.
Develop and maintain RESTful APIs for integration with third-party systems.
Implement authentication and authorization mechanisms.
Support application deployments and resolve post-deployment issues.
Monitor system performance and implement improvements.
Assist in migrating legacy applications to modern technology stacks.
Implement secure coding practices to prevent vulnerabilities.
Work with DevOps to streamline deployment pipelines.
Optimize front-end performance and implement caching strategies.
Integrate with cloud-based services and APIs.
Participate in software design discussions and suggest improvements.
Develop reusable components for efficient development cycles.
Implement error handling and logging mechanisms.
Write SQL queries and optimize database interactions.
Debug cross-browser compatibility issues.
Automate repetitive development tasks using scripts.
Create scalable and maintainable applications to meet the WDA's long-term needs.
Integrate and maintain business-driven workflows into the application platform.
Implement data entry forms and reporting tools in alignment with business requirements.
Use agile principles to prioritize development tasks and meet business deadlines.
Create and optimize SQL queries for reporting tools and financial data processing.
Develop and integrate automated notifications and reminders related to project timelines and submissions.
Implement real-time data updates and ensure they are visible on the executive dashboards.
Work with project teams to refine product features based on user feedback and testing results.
Ensure all code is optimized for both performance and scalability.
Work with the team to transition legacy systems to modern frameworks.
Ensure secure coding practices for web and mobile applications.
Troubleshoot front-end and back-end application issues and bugs.
Responsibilities:
Design, develop, test, and maintain software applications.
Write clean, scalable, and efficient code following best practices.
Troubleshoot and resolve application bugs and issues.
Implement backend services, APIs, and database logic.
Collaborate with cross-functional teams including UI/UX designers and business analysts.
Follow Agile methodologies and participate in sprint planning meetings.
Develop responsive web applications using front-end frameworks.
Ensure data consistency and integrity through proper database management.
Conduct performance testing and optimizations for application speed and security.
Maintain system documentation and update technical manuals.
Develop and maintain RESTful APIs for integration with third-party systems.
Implement authentication and authorization mechanisms.
Support application deployments and resolve post-deployment issues.
Monitor system performance and implement improvements.
Assist in migrating legacy applications to modern technology stacks.
Implement secure coding practices to prevent vulnerabilities.
Work with DevOps to streamline deployment pipelines.
Optimize front-end performance and implement caching strategies.
Integrate with cloud-based services and APIs.
Participate in software design discussions and suggest improvements.
Develop reusable components for efficient development cycles.
Implement error handling and logging mechanisms.
Write SQL queries and optimize database interactions.
Debug cross-browser compatibility issues.
Automate repetitive development tasks using scripts.
Create scalable and maintainable applications to meet the WDA's long-term needs.
Integrate and maintain business-driven workflows into the application platform.
Implement data entry forms and reporting tools in alignment with business requirements.
Use agile principles to prioritize development tasks and meet business deadlines.
Create and optimize SQL queries for reporting tools and financial data processing.
Develop and integrate automated notifications and reminders related to project timelines and submissions.
Implement real-time data updates and ensure they are visible on the executive dashboards.
Work with project teams to refine product features based on user feedback and testing results.
Ensure all code is optimized for both performance and scalability.
Work with the team to transition legacy systems to modern frameworks.
Ensure secure coding practices for web and mobile applications.
Troubleshoot front-end and back-end application issues and bugs.
Qualifications:
Bachelor's degree in Computer Science or related field.
2+ years of experience in software development.
Knowledge of front-end and back-end technologies.
Ability to work collaboratively with other team members.
Experience with APIs and cloud-based technologies.
Bachelor's degree in Computer Science or related field.
2+ years of experience in software development.
Knowledge of front-end and back-end technologies.
Ability to work collaboratively with other team members.
Experience with APIs and cloud-based technologies.
Technology Stacks:
Languages: Java, C#, JavaScript, Python
Frameworks: React, Angular, Vue.js, Node.js
Databases: MongoDB, MySQL, PostgreSQL
Tools: Git, Jenkins, Jira, Docker
Cloud: AWS, Azure, Google Cloud
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
Report this job